Chapter 357: Bringing Gifts to the Dance Family, Seeking to Marry the Thousand Gold Maiden. [357]



Summary

The story unfolds with Qin Ying preparing to propose to Wu Qingqiu, despite already having a legitimate wife, Liu Yun Xian. The customs of the Great Han dictate that any future marriage would render Wu Qingqiu a concubine. Qin Ying values all his women equally, ensuring that the proposal to the Wu family is conducted with utmost respect. Upon arrival at the Wu estate, he is warmly welcomed, and he affectionately takes Wu Qingqiu's hand, causing her to blush. Their relationship, marked by intimacy, is highlighted amidst the formalities of marriage customs. The narrative emphasizes the contrast between ancient marriage traditions and personal feelings, showcasing Qin Ying's genuine affection for Wu Qingqiu.
